A LORRY burst into flames at the Forth road bridge this morning, causing delays for rush-hour commuters.
Lothian and Borders Fire service rushed to the scene at 8.13am today as a large lorry was on fire on the southbound carriageway.
The large red vehicle contained bags of paper in its cargo.
The southbound lane of the bridge was closed for a short period of time while 10 fire fighters extinguished the fire.
Firefighters used breathing gear and a hose was used to tackle the flames.
One onlooker said: “I was stuck in a queue of traffic on the bridge and when I reached the other side I could see about 7 or 8 fire fighters and two engines surrounding the lorry.
“One fireman was spraying water to the bottom part of the vehicle and they were stopping people from getting too close.”
No injuries were reported from the incident.
